NSU member ‘swindles’ 11m
KATHMANDU, SEP 05 -
A central member of the Nepal Students’ Union (NSU), the student wing of the Nepali Congress, has been accused of defrauding over two dozen people of over Rs. 11.5 million.
Police said NSU member Santosh Bhatta of Gorkha allegedly defrauded at least 25 people, who have lodged a complaint at the Metropolitan Police Range Hanumandhoka. Bhatta, a former president of the Free Students’ Union in Bishwo Bhasa Campus, is on the run for the past few months. A preliminary investigation indicated that Bhatta spent a lot of money in casinos by borrowing from his colleagues and acquaintances.
